1,2,3-Propanetriol, 1-(dihydrogen phosphate), trisodium salt

Description:
1,2,3-Propanetriol, 1-(dihydrogen phosphate), trisodium salt, commonly known as sodium glycerophosphate, is a chemical compound that serves as a source of phosphate in various biochemical applications. It is a white, crystalline powder that is soluble in water, making it suitable for use in aqueous solutions. This compound is characterized by its ability to act as a buffering agent and is often utilized in biological and pharmaceutical formulations. The presence of three sodium ions contributes to its ionic nature, enhancing its solubility and reactivity in biological systems. Sodium glycerophosphate is also recognized for its role in cellular metabolism, particularly in energy production and as a component of phospholipids. Additionally, it may be used in food and cosmetic formulations due to its moisturizing properties. Safety data indicates that it is generally regarded as safe for use in food and pharmaceutical applications, although standard handling precautions should be observed to avoid any potential irritation.
